A Brief History of the Venetian Walls

The story of Nicosia's fortifications began in the Lusignan period, with the initial construction of walls around the city. However, it was in the 16th century when the Venetian Walls took their present shape, as a defense mechanism against the imminent threat of the Ottoman Empire. The walls, designed by renowned Italian military engineer Giulio Savorgnano, featured a series of bastions and gates that allowed for both the protection and control of the city. Despite their innovative design, the walls were unable to withstand the Ottoman invasion of 1570, which led to the capture of Nicosia.

Exploring the Venetian Walls: Key Attractions

1. Famagusta Gate

As the largest and most impressive gate of the Venetian Walls, Famagusta Gate boasts a rich history and significant role in Nicosia's past. Once the main entrance to the city, it now serves as a cultural center hosting exhibitions, performances, and other events. The beautifully restored gate is a testament to the architectural prowess of the Venetian era and a must-visit spot for history enthusiasts.

2. Kyrenia Gate

Another vital entrance to the city, Kyrenia Gate, features unique architectural elements that showcase the blend of Venetian and Ottoman influences. Over the years, restoration efforts have maintained the gate's historical charm while ensuring its structural integrity. Visitors can walk through the gate and explore the area, which includes museums and traditional Cypriot architecture.

4. The Bastions

The Venetian Walls consist of 11 bastions, each named after a noble Venetian family. While all the bastions are worth exploring, some of the most notable examples include Caraffa, Tripoli, and Constanza Bastions. These impressive structures offer stunning views of the city and surrounding areas, providing visitors with a unique perspective on Nicosia's past and present.

Protecting and Preserving the Venetian Walls

Over the years, numerous conservation initiatives have been undertaken to protect and preserve the Venetian Walls. The walls' historical and cultural significance has garnered attention from local and international organizations, with efforts focused on maintenance, restoration, and raising public awareness. Although the Venetian Walls are not yet recognized as a UNESCO World Heritage Site, their potential for inclusion in the future highlights the importance of ongoing preservation efforts.
